The global biofuels industry finds itself at a critical inflection point as we enter March 2025, with converging pressures from trade policy uncertainty, shifting feedstock dynamics, and evolving regulatory landscapes. Trump's impending tariffs—25% on non-energy imports from Canada and Mexico, 10% on Canadian energy imports, and an additional 10% on Chinese goods—cast a long shadow over the market. For biofuel traders, this represents the first major trade disruption in years, with potentially significant implications for UCO flows from China to the US and vegetable oil trade patterns globally. Market participants are already reporting UCO diversions from the US to Europe, a trend that will likely accelerate if these tariffs are implemented as planned on March 4th. Volume data confirms this shift, with approximately 32,000 tons of Chinese UCO scheduled to arrive in Huelva, Spain on March 20th, according to vessel tracking data. Simultaneously, South African UCO suppliers are offering product at $1,110/t cif ARA, while Chinese T1 material in flexitanks is offered at $1,125/t for March delivery—all indications of a market reorienting itself ahead of potential trade barriers.
Biodiesel economics face significant headwinds as the sector grapples with deteriorating margins and uncertain policy environments. In the US, crush margins have moved into negative territory at approximately -38 cents/gallon, putting considerable pressure on producers. This weakness coincides with a marked decline in RIN credit values, which have fallen substantially from their 2024 highs. Market participants report that biodiesel production rates are adjusting downward in response to these challenging conditions.
The European biodiesel landscape presents a similarly difficult picture, with Germany's exports reaching record levels (3.2 million tonnes in 2024) as domestic demand growth stagnates. The Netherlands has become Germany's primary export destination, with shipments increasing by approximately 20% year-on-year, while exports to Belgium surged by nearly 80%. This shift toward export dependency signals structural challenges in the European market, where double-counting mechanisms for waste-based biofuels continue to distort traditional blending economics.

Trading patterns suggest waste-based biodiesel still commands significant premiums over crop-based alternatives, despite the challenging overall market conditions. Domestic regulatory compliance requirements increasingly drive purchasing decisions rather than purely commercial considerations. Industry sources indicate that several European biodiesel producers are exploring alternative markets as they navigate this complex landscape. Meanwhile, policy developments continue to reshape regional markets, with Brazil suspending its planned increase to B15 blend rates, while Indonesia maintains its ambitious B40 program with implementation targeted for mid year.
Renewable diesel/HVO continues to hold a premium position in the alternative fuels landscape, though market participants report increasing pressure on margins. The substantial price differential between HVO and conventional biodiesel remains a defining feature of the market, reflecting both the superior fuel properties and the regulatory advantages HVO offers. However, recent data suggests a potential slowdown in the sector's rapid growth trajectory, with concerns about feedstock availability and shifting policy priorities.
The global outlook for combined biodiesel and HVO production in 2025 appears less robust than in previous years, with industry analysts projecting potential flattening or even modest contraction compared to the 3-4 million ton annual increases observed in recent years. This shift reflects both practical limitations in feedstock supply chains and evolving policy frameworks across major markets. Regional divergence continues to characterize the sector, with Indonesia advancing its ambitious B40 program while Brazil has temporarily paused its planned biodiesel blend increase.
North American renewable diesel capacity faces a period of adjustment as British Columbia announced renewable fuel requirements must be met with Canadian-produced fuels beginning April 2025. This regulatory shift will redirect volumes and potentially reshape supply chains that previously relied on imports from Asia and the US. European refiners continue to advance HVO projects despite some reports of temporary demand softness, evidently focused on longer-term transition plans. The forward market structure suggests continued confidence in the sector's fundamentals, with trading in quarterly and half-yearly contracts showing sustained premiums that reflect expectations of ongoing supply-demand imbalance.
The SAF market continues to develop gradually, with market participants reporting prices remaining at substantial premiums to conventional jet fuel. Industry analysts expect modest growth in the near term as regulatory mandates begin to take effect across various jurisdictions. Bloomberg's aviation forecasts suggest SAF will represent approximately 7% of global jet fuel demand by 2050, indicating a long runway for market development. The Asia-Pacific region is gaining momentum with Singapore and South Korea implementing mandates of 1% in the 2026-2027 timeframe.
The most significant recent development is Japan's Ministry of Economy, Trade and Industry's decision to provide financial support for a major SAF production facility—marking the first time METI has directly subsidized biofuel production. This unprecedented policy shift will support Cosmo Oil and Mitsui & Co's project utilizing alcohol-to-jet technology from LanzaJet, diversifying beyond the HEFA pathway that currently dominates global SAF production. Scheduled for completion in 2029 at the Sakaide Logistics Base, the facility aims to produce 150,000 kiloliters of SAF annually, establishing Japan's first large-scale domestic SAF production capacity. This represents a fundamental shift in Japan's approach to alternative fuels, which has historically favored other decarbonization pathways. Industry observers suggest this could signal wider government support for biofuels in one of Asia's largest energy markets, potentially creating new opportunities for feedstock suppliers and technology providers.
Other notable developments include Saudi Arabia's introduction of a 35% SAF blend option at Red Sea International Airport and India's efforts to establish certification infrastructure through a partnership between ISCC and the National Accreditation Board for Certification Bodies. The hydroprocessing route remains dominant for SAF production despite feedstock constraints, with 2024 seeing capacity additions from several major producers. The diversification toward alcohol-to-jet and other emerging pathways is increasingly viewed as necessary to achieve scale without exacerbating feedstock limitations. Meanwhile, marine biofuel markets continue to develop their own dynamics, with B24 blends (24% biodiesel in VLSFO) becoming the industry standard for operators seeking to reduce their environmental footprint. Recent pricing shows considerable regional variation, with B24 in key Asian ports trading in the $660-670/t range while Mediterranean locations command significant premiums. Market observers note the spread between Singapore and European destinations has expanded to over $160/t, creating potential arbitrage opportunities despite logistical challenges. Trading volumes remain relatively thin as shipping companies primarily focus on spot purchases rather than term contracts. The market continues to be divided between early adopters pursuing voluntary emissions reductions and those positioning for eventual regulatory compliance. Prices across major Asian ports have softened slightly in recent weeks, tracking the underlying fossil fuel markets while maintaining typical premiums. The emerging regional price differentials reflect both supply-demand balances and the uneven infrastructure development for biofuel bunkering globally. Physical demand remains modest but steady, primarily from container lines and cruise operators with established sustainability programs.
Vegetable oil markets provide essential context for biofuel developments, with soybean oil currently positioned as the most competitively priced major vegetable oil. Recent trade reports indicate significant export volumes from the US, with market observers noting approximately 200,000 tons declared for export last week, likely destined for India where demand remains robust. This competitiveness comes despite substantial global soybean production, which is expected to lead to increased world stocks for the third consecutive year.
Global soybean processing volumes continue to increase significantly, with a projected rise of 23 million tons to reach 353 million tons in the current marketing year. Argentina has shown particularly strong growth in processing activity, with January crush volumes approximately 36% higher than the previous year. This increased processing capacity creates abundant soybean oil supply at a time when palm oil production faces ongoing constraints.
Palm oil market analysts expect prices to moderate in the first half of 2025, potentially declining to the $900-945/t range by mid-year before stabilizing. This projection comes amid expectations of rising Indonesian production but continued tight supplies in Malaysia and other producing regions. The persistent premium of vegetable oils relative to petroleum diesel (with POGO and BOGO spreads running above $335/mt) continues to challenge the economics of first-generation biofuels, while reinforcing the search for lower-cost feedstock alternatives. These fundamentals, combined with heightened policy uncertainty and potential trade disruptions, create a complex environment for biofuel producers reliant on vegetable oil inputs, with regional differences in feedstock availability and pricing providing both challenges and selective opportunities for market participants.
